Transaction 2966903a9aa1015a22768798345ff73e061ef5c9aa76b3b5e4fe497554cc6381
1 Input
1 Output
-
2966903a9aa1015a22768798345ff73e061ef5c9aa76b3b5e4fe497554cc6381:0
- value
- 475059
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 11278450c66eb51ebe3e420d7f9f32a73da0b0e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12ZhpwYtScfWakCmuopzEVrjk7fETy5YZh